#5645f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5645f1 is composed of 33.7% red, 27.1%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 60.8%. #5645f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ac8aff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#5645f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5645f1 has RGB values of R:86, G:69,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5654001.

Shades and Tints of #5645f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5645f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9a9c is the less saturated color, while #503df9 is the most saturated one.
